A Feather So Black by Lyra Selene
Tumblr media
Lyrical and magical, A Feather So Black is a lush, romantic fantasy novel sure to enchant readers. I was worried, at first, that it would be a(nother) imitation of Maas’s blockbuster series that now proliferate the genre. And in some ways, I think it still may be. But Selene’s book stands strong on its own, thanks to a grounding in Irish folklore and culture. While I cannot be sure as to the veracity of her world to Irish myth and historical roots, the flavour of it is there, which will probably be enough for most readers. Certainly not a perfect book—parts of it are under-explained and under-developed, and some B and C-plots use up many pages, only to go nowhere. I can only hope that subsequent books, perhaps, help them have payoff. And I still am not sure if Fia’s character arc is well-written or not. But for all of that, I thoroughly enjoyed most of the book and was happily swept into Selene’s world. I suspect many readers will feel the same. Thanks to NetGalley and Orbit Books for the ebook ARC. A Crown So Silver, Lyra Selene
Tumblr media
Rounding up to 4 stars.
First and foremost, I would like to thank the publisher and NetGalley for the ARC, all thoughts are my own.
A Crown So Silver opens with a slow pace and does not fully pick up until about the 55% mark. I had a difficult time making my way through the first half for a few reasons. I was a bit unsure about the setting change at first, though I ended up enjoying it. And secondly, I absolutely LOVED the FMC, Fia, in A Feather So Black, but was really quickly annoyed with her in the first half of the book. Her character seemed to shift, and I didn't understand why she was acting so impulsively and a bit immature. And I was a bit confused how quickly so much conflict developed with the MMC, Irian, especially as it seemed their characters developed together in the first book.
BUT I am so glad I kept reading, because the second half of the book was really great. Fia's character change, actions, and the difficulties in her relationship were more heavily explained, and I began to understand and feel more empathetic towards her character. Additionally, we learned much more about Irian and what motivated his actions, which allowed for more development of their characters together. It was suspenseful, magically, and that ending!!!!! I cannot believe I will have to wait so long to get answers! The second half of the book is what brought this up to four stars for me.
Lyra Selene is fantastic, and I think her writing is beautiful!
I would 100% recommend both A Feather So Black and A Crown So Silver, and truly urge readers to be patient with the book while the story develops. It is worth it! Really, really looking forward to the next book.

possibly controversial opinion but a feather so black by lyra selene has such a better romance with a morally gray shadow-themed faerie guy than a court of thorns and roses that it's not even a competition. wild how books are better when authors understand that morally gray means "does bad things but feels that they are necessary" rather than "is an asshole to people but is secretly good underneath" and also that love interests should, you know, respect and support the main character rather than belittling and tormenting them.

A Feather So Black by Lyra Selene - ARC Review!
In a kingdom where magic has been lost, Fia is a rare changeling, left behind by the wicked Fair Folk when they stole the High Queen’s daughter and retreated behind the locked gates of Tír na nÓg. Most despise Fia’s fae blood. But the queen raises her as a daughter and trains her to be a spy. Meanwhile, the real princess Eala is bound to Tír na nÓg, cursed to become a swan by day and only…
